> Hi Anish,
> I also think it's just a mis-count on the End If's
> You can simplify your code like this.
>
>
> Sub dept()
>     i = 1
>     z = Cells(Rows.Count, "B").End(xlUp).Row
>     While i <= z
>         If Cells(i, 2).Value Like "*FINANCE*" Then Cells(i, 4) = "FINANCE /
> ACCOUNTING": GoTo 100
>         If Cells(i, 2).Value Like "*ACCOUNTS*" Then Cells(i, 4) = "FINANACE
> / ACCOUNTING": GoTo 100
>         If Cells(i, 2).Value Like "*SALES*" Then Cells(i, 4) = "SALES":
> GoTo 100
>         '(IN BETWEEN THR R MORE THAN 100 IF CONDITIONS LIKE THIS)
> 100
>     i = i + 1
>     Wend
> End Sub
>
> Some programmers disapprove of using GoTo, but for your code it removes the
> need for End If's.

> Hello Experts..
>
> I m using While and Wend statement in my code and it has got more than 100
> if conditions. when I run the macro it says "WEND WITHOUT WHILE", it's
> buggin my head...and I don know wht's wrong. Could anyone of you please help
> me...
>
> Sample code...
>
> Sub dept()
> i = 1
> z = Cells(Rows.Count, "B").End(xlUp).Row
> While i <= z
> If Cells(i, 2).Value Like "*FINANCE*" Then
> Cells(i, 4) = "FINANCE / ACCOUNTING"
> Else
> If Cells(i, 2).Value Like "*ACCOUNTS*" Then
> Cells(i, 4) = "FINANACE / ACCOUNTING"
> Else
> If Cells(i, 2).Value Like "*SALES*" Then
> Cells(i, 4) = "SALES"
> *(IN BETWEEN THR R MORE THAN 100 IF CONDITIONS LIKE THIS)*
> endif
> endif
> endif
> i=i+1
> wend
> end sub
